Key Information

Short Description

Gabanist-NT Tablet is a combination medicine used for the treatment of neuropathic pain.

Dosage Form

Tablet

Introduction

Gabanist-NT Tablet is a combination medicine used for the treatment of neuropathic pain. This medicine decreases the pain by stopping the movement of pain signals to the brain.

Directions for Use

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Swallow it as a whole. Do not chew, crush or break it. Gabanist-NT Tablet may be taken with or without food but it is better to take it at a fixed time.

How it works

Gabanist-NT Tablet is a combination of two medicines: Gabapentin and Nortriptyline. Gabapentin is an alpha 2 delta ligand which decreases the pain by modulating calcium channel activity of the nerve cells. Nortriptyline is a tricyclic antidepressant which increases the levels of chemical messengers (serotonin and noradrenaline) that stop the movement of pain signals in the brain. Together they relieve neuropathic pain (pain from damaged nerves).

Quick Tips

Take Gabanist-NT Tablet as advised by your doctor. Along with taking this medicine, your doctor might advise you to undergo physiotherapy to get relief from pain. Along with taking this medicine, your doctor might advise you to avoid taking antacids 2 hours before or after taking Gabanist-NT Tablet as they make it harder for your body to absorb the medicine. Frequently asked questions

What is Gabanist-NT Tablet?

Gabanist-NT Tablet contains two active ingredients: Gabapentin and Nortriptyline. It's used to treat nerve pain (neuropathic pain). The medication works by influencing brain activity, reducing the perception of pain signals from damaged or overactive nerves.

Can I stop taking Gabanist-NT Tablet when my pain is relieved?

No. You should continue taking Gabanist-NT Tablet as prescribed by your doctor, even if your pain is reduced. If you suddenly stop taking the medication, you may experience withdrawal symptoms such as anxiety, sleep difficulties, nausea, pain and sweating. Gradual dose tapering before complete discontinuation might be required to minimize side effects.

How can I manage weight gain associated with Gabanist-NT Tablet?

Gabanist-NT Tablet may cause increased appetite and lead to weight gain. However, it's easier to prevent weight gain than to lose the extra weight once gained. Maintain a healthy diet with balanced meals without increasing portion sizes. Avoid high-calorie foods such as soft drinks, oily food, chips, cakes, biscuits, and sweets. Instead, focus on fruits, vegetables, and low-calorie options. Regular exercise can also help prevent weight gain.

Can Gabanist-NT Tablet affect my sexual life?

Gabanist-NT Tablet can impact both men and women's sex life. Common side effects include decreased libido, erectile dysfunction (difficulty achieving or maintaining erection), difficulty reaching orgasm, and a decrease in satisfaction levels. If you experience these difficulties, discuss them with your doctor but do not discontinue the medication.

Are there any serious side effects associated with Gabanist-NT Tablet?

While rare, some serious side effects can occur when taking Gabanist-NT Tablet. Seek immediate medical attention if you experience: significant changes in body temperature, difficulty breathing, increased heartbeat (palpitations), double vision, slurred speech or diarrhea, confusion, blurred vision, dizziness, rapid temperature changes (high and low), difficulty breathing and rapid heartbeat.

Are there any things I need to avoid while taking Gabanist-NT Tablet?

Gabanist-NT Tablet may impair thinking or reaction speed. Be cautious while driving, operating machinery, working at heights, or engaging in potentially dangerous activities until you understand how the medication affects you. Avoid drinking alcohol as it can increase the effects of alcohol and become risky. Grapefruit and grapefruit juice can also interact with this medication, so avoid them when taking Gabanist-NT Tablet.

How often should I see the doctor while taking Gabanist-NT Tablet?

Regular checkups with your doctor may be needed if you've started taking Gabanist-NT Tablet. If your symptoms do not improve or if you experience unwanted side effects that disrupt your routine, consult your doctor for re-evaluation.

Will Gabanist-NT Tablet make me feel sleepy?

Yes, Gabanist-NT Tablet can cause drowsiness. It's important to be aware of this side effect and avoid driving or operating machinery until you know how the medication affects you. If you experience excessive sleepiness while taking this medication, talk with your doctor.

Is it safe to take more than the recommended dose?

No. Taking a higher dose of Gabanist-NT Tablet is not advisable as it may lead to increased side effects and toxicity. If you experience heightened symptom severity that isn't relieved by the prescribed dosage, consult your doctor for a re-evaluation.

What are the storage conditions for Gabanist-NT Tablet?

Keep your tablets in their original packaging until you’re ready to take them. Store them in a cool, dry place away from children and pets. If you're not going to use your medication soon, dispose of unused medications properly. This prevents them from being accessible by others or potentially contaminating the environment.
